Summary

The NVFLARE product by NVIDIA, prior to version 2.1.2, features a vulnerability in its utils module. This flaw arises from the use of yaml.load() instead of the safer yaml.safe_load() for loading YAML files. An unprivileged network attacker can exploit this weakness, potentially resulting in remote code execution, denial of service, and detrimental impacts on data confidentiality and integrity.

Affected Version(s)

NVIDIA FLARE All versions prior to 2.1.2
